Who is the RDN Tax Payers Alliance:

We are a group of Residents and Neighbourhood Associations, from across the Regional District of Nanaimo (RDN) to form the RDN Taxpayers Alliance (RDNTA).

Why Have We Come Together?

We have formed because of continued ‘Excessive RDN Tax Increases’ that are outpacing inflation, regional growth and most importantly family incomes.  This is straining family budgets, undermining families’ financial confidence, and resulting in financial hardship.  We recognize that our community services are not sustainable if our families are not financially sustainable.    

The Core Issue

The Tax Pile-on Continues.  RDN & Hospital Taxes are planned to increase 75% from 2025-2029.  This increase is more than 7 times expected inflation and well ahead of both regional growth and income growth.  This ongoing rate of tax increase is unsustainable.  We see four major root causes:

1) A Poor Financial Planning Process that doesn’t guarantee fiscal balance or financial accountability.

2) Run-Away Capital Spending with limited prioritization between or within departments based on the difference between needs & wants or sustainable financial capacity.

3) Ineffective Project Management that often fails to design financially efficient projects or bring them in on-time on-budget.

4) Limited Transparency, Unbalanced Representation, and Limited Accountability.
